Sims Suddenly Won't Launch (I've read everything & I don't understand)

Hello! I have been playing Sims 4 without any issues for a few weeks. I have DLC and mods and everything has been fine until yesterday. I purchased the Desert Luxe DLC on Steam and now the game won't launch. It says "Application Not Found." I haven't messed with any of the files or even used my computer at all since playing yesterday. I have a PC and downloaded the game from Steam. I have the EA app but after reading a bunch of help articles it sounds like I need Origin? I was able to play the game without it so I don't know what is happening. I have read many help articles and can't find anyone else with the same situation. Please help! Thank you!

    DOUBLE UPDATE: I don't know how this worked but I fixed it myself. I repaired the EA app, as mentioned, then couldn't get EA to launch Sims. I restarted my computer (which was the first thing I tried when this problem began, ugh) and then it just completely runs as normal. Has my saves and everything (it didn't when I got it to launch but needed to restart). I hope anyone who has the same problem finds this thread.

  • UPDATE: I tried to open the EA app and my computer couldn't find the app, so I tried to reinstall it. Then my computer said EA was already installed, so I clicked "repair" which allowed me to initially launch the game. Then Sims said I should relaunch the game so that I could use my new DLC, and now it won't open. EA opens and lets me click play, and then the game doesn't launch. I'm losing my mind.
